From Dallas's Message to Family Members the day after Emma's Passing:

Our little precious Emma Grace was taken home by the Lord yesterday around 5pm. She's had a rough past week, and she acquired a new systemic infection that got into her bloodstream and caused septic shock and massive hypotension.

Her blood pressure plummetted and doctors tried everything they could to fix the situation but nothing seemed to work. Without blood pressure, her kidneys were unable to filter out the extra fluid they were giving her to increase her pressure and wasn't able to get rid of the potassium that they usually do. The fluid had nowhere to go but into her skin and into open spaces in her abdomen. Emma fought long and bravely but in the end just couldn't fight anymore. Her potassium was just too high and her heart slowly stopped beating.

Elizabeth and I were with her at the end. We knew Emma was going to die when the doctors asked if we wanted to hold her. We've wanted to hold her for so long, but not that way. Not then.

Elizabeth held her first. I was able to hold my little girl for the first and last time as she squeezed Elizabeth's finger as if to say "It's ok mom, Jesus and Madeline need me now." We sang hymns..."Jesus Loves Me" and "It Is Well With My Soul" to her until her heart stopped beating and they turned off the respirator.

Emma suffered more in three weeks of life than most people experience in a lifetime. She didn't deserve that. She's not suffering anymore and she's with her twin sister Madeline now. Our main comfort is that we WILL see her again when this life ends and our little girls are going to be waiting for us there and to show us around heaven. I can't wait to see Emma again, this time in a body that doesn't break down, in a world that isn't full of death and sorrow and suffering and to meet little Madeline, who gave her life so her twin could live on a little longer to see her mom and dad.

Please pray for me and Elizabeth as we're disillusioned, heartbroken, and searching for answers we're not likely to find in this lifetime.

We love you Emma Grace and Madeline Elizabeth. We always will.
